automatisches Kopieren in NT Umgebung

icke!

Cadet 1st Year
Registriert
Dez. 2004
Beiträge
12
Hallo alle zusammen.


ich bin zwar noch nicht lange bei computerbase. ich würde mich aber sehr freuen, wenn mir schnell geholfen wird :)

ich versuche gerade von einem Server NTSERVA automatisch Daten zum NTSERVB zu kopieren.

auf dem NTSERVA starte ich per at 23:00 /every:Mo,Di,Mi,Do,Fr c:\kopieren.bat

kopieren.bat sieht so aus

rem @echo off
rem Verbindung zum Verzeichnis herstellen
net use x: \\NTSERVB\freigabe passwort

rem kopieren der Daten
xcopy x:\freigabe c:\kopiertedaten /s/e/v/h/i

rem trennen der Verbindung
net use x: /d

die Verbindung wird aufgebaut und auch wieder getrennt, jedoch wird der xcopy Befehl nicht automatisch ausgeführt

führt man die kopieren.bat von Hand aus klappt alles wunderbar und die Daten werden kopiert


Danke für eure Antworten

mfg icke!

//Ich habe mal dein Thread in das richtige Forum für Betriebssysteme verschoben.
Gruß Fiona
 
Zuletzt bearbeitet von einem Moderator:
Willkommen auf FB!!! :schluck:
Wieso stellst du deinen Thread in das Feedback Forum? :p

So ein Problem hatte ich auch schon einmal. Ich hatte keine Ahnung wieso es manchmal ging und manchmal nicht. Ich vermutete Gottes Hand. Bei dem Problem würde ich dir raten, die ganze Sache neu zu schreiben und zu betten.
;)
 
Wie gesagt ich in neu bei C Base und deshalb ist mein Beitrag im Feedback Forum gelandet. Wo hätte ich es sonst reinschreiben sollen?


Da du ja dieses Problemchen auch schon mal hattest, könntest Du mir bitte Deinen Code von der Batch Datei zeigen (wenn Du Ihn noch hast)


Also beten und hoffen bringt mir nichts. Sorry aber dat muss irgendwie klappen.
 
Auf den ersten Blick hast du Quelle und Zeil vertauscht beim xcopy-Befehl.
Warum das dann trotzdem läuft, wenn du die bat manuell startest ist mir schleierhaft.
 
@echo off
rem Verbindung zum Verzeichnis herstellen
net use x: \\NTSERVA\freigabe passwort

rem kopieren der Daten
xcopy x:\*.* c:\kopiertedaten /s/e/v/h/i

rem trennen der Verbindung
net use x: /d

Sorry ich hatte Scheibfehler.

Ich habe das Problem aber weiterhin
manuell klapps


Hat einer eine ähnliche Batch Datei oder eine komplett andere funktionierende Möglichkeit gefunden automatisch Daten zwischen zwei NT 4.0 Servern zu kopieren

Danke

mfg Icke!
 
icke! schrieb:
@echo off
rem Verbindung zum Verzeichnis herstellen
net use x: \\NTSERVA\freigabe passwort

rem kopieren der Daten
xcopy x:\*.* c:\kopiertedaten /s/e/v/h/i

rem trennen der Verbindung
net use x: /d

Sorry ich hatte Scheibfehler.

Ich habe das Problem aber weiterhin
manuell klappts
Du könntest zur Fehleranalyse mal ein if einbauen. Bespiel:

Code:
@echo off
rem Verbindung zum Verzeichnis herstellen
net use x: \\NTSERV[COLOR=DarkRed]A[/COLOR]\freigabe passwort 
if exist x: goto weiter
echo Netzlaufwerk konnte nicht hergestellt werden
pause
goto exit

:weiter
rem kopieren der Daten
xcopy x:\[COLOR=DarkRed]*.* [/COLOR] c:\kopiertedaten /s/e/v/h/i

rem trennen der Verbindung
net use x: /d

:exit
exit
Somit weisst du beim nächsten mal (wenn es wieder nicht funktioniert) das du ein Konnektivitätsproblem hast (was ich jetzt auch vermuten würde), das kann dr bei der Fehlersuche sicher weiterhelfen.
 
Danke für Eure Unterstützung. Leider funktionierte auch der Replikationsdienst nicht richtig. Vielleicht lag es auch daran, dass ich genau nach der Windowshilfe die Einstellungen getroffen hatte. Den einen Server hatte ich als Import und den anderen als Exportserver eingestellt.

Naja. Kurze Rede.

mit TrayBackup hats funtioniert. Einfach installiert, und Daten ausgewählt. Ne bpr Dtei erstellt in der alle Daten stehen welche gesichtert werden.Ne Batch geschrieben, mit der traybackup gestartet wird (mit bpr) und auch wieder schließt. Mit dem Taskmanager den Zeitpunkt geplant. Und ab ging die Post.


Juhu :cool_alt:
 
Zurück
Oben